The deadly famine in the Gaza Strip left a house unless it knocked on its doors, nor a child, except for its weight on him, without separating a patient or a healthy, large or small.
As the Israeli occupation army continued – months ago – to close the stricken Palestinian sector crossings and prevent the introduction of humanitarian supplies, the residents live in an unprecedented humanitarian catastrophe as hunger has become a tragic daily scene that kills all groups, and in particular children, women and the elderly.
Amidst this tragic scene, one of the most painful stories is reflected, narrated by the photojournalist Majdi Qarai, about his son who has autism who did not understand the meaning of war or siege, but in the silent pain of pain of his hunger, he did not do before.
Qi’i did not imagine one day that his son, who is with autism, would come to him to express his hunger, and he does not speak, except that the famine that is spread throughout Gaza made him come to him, hitting with his small hand on his stomach heavily, in an unlicensed cry, but it is understood “I am hungry.”
“In light of the deadly starvation, I will talk to you about my autistic son. Since I discovered his injury, I devoted my time and me to help him learn and fill his day between the institution in which he qualifies, and recreational activities such as the bike ride at the Yarmouk Stadium, and swimming in a private pool. He was not asking about food because of his abundance The house, that was part of its treatment and emptying its negative energy. “
It is noteworthy that since the beginning of the war, everything has disappeared “and stopped taking his son abroad due to the frequent waves of displacement, and the destruction of the places he used to go with him, adding” his behavior changed significantly, as if everything that I built with him over the years suddenly collapsed. “
“Yesterday, for the first time, he came to hit his hand on his stomach heavily. He does not speak, as if he clearly tells me: I am hungry. There is nothing that I bought for him or his brothers. He does not know that we are in a war or in a famine … he just wants to eat.”
The publication of the photographer has received a wide interaction on the communication platforms in the sector, and many commentators expressed their deep sorrow, stressing that the story of this autistic patient is not an exception, but rather a wide segment of children who suffer silently.
One of them commented, “This is the story of one child with autism, but there are hundreds of cases that have not yet been revealed in light of the brutal and famine war that strikes the sector.”
Moghroufon pointed out that many Gaza children suffer from severe malnutrition, and that the urgent need to provide food and care, especially for people with special needs, because they do not understand the meaning of war or the loss of food, all they want is to eat.
Another wrote a painful comment, “My daughter is one and a half years old, yesterday, she said to me: Baba Ninah (bread) … I did not know what to say to her.”
Other bloggers have considered that autistic children in Gaza are facing complex difficulties. Besides food lack, the continuous sounds of the shelling for nearly 22 months affect them psychologically and behaviorally, which requires urgent intervention to protect and care for them.
